What did the study find?
900 people were included in this study. All these were students of five different universities and their social contacts, which were studied before, during, and after the pandemic lockdown. The purpose of the study was to understand the quality of communication in the context of relationships. All the people were asked to engage in one of seven communication behaviors during the day and then at night to report on stress, connection, anxiety, well-being, loneliness, and the quality of their day.

There were 7 communication behaviors-
Talk to someone
Care more
Hear


Value others and their opinions
Compliment each other
Talk sense
To joke


The study found that individually these behaviors had no significant effect on mental health.

Both quantity and quality are important
The study aims to understand the impact of both the quantity and quality of daily conversations. This showed that both the frequency of communication and its quality was equally important. Those who chose to have more quality conversations had better days. According to the lead author, if your friends listen more and care more, it can boost your mental health. The study found that in comparison to electronic or social media contact if you talk to your friend face to face, your mental health will be better.
